Robery reported in the capital's "Minor" mosque
On July 8, in the “Minor” mosque located in the Yunusabad district, an 18-year-old boy, together with two of his criminal accomplices, stole a bag worth $70 belonging to a 25-year-old visitor, the press service of the Central Internal Affairs Directorate of Tashkent reports.
Reportedly, the bag contained a powerbank, a purse, a mobile phone, an air ticket and a large amount of money in national and foreign currency.
While trying to flee from the scene of the crime, the suspect was detained by a police officer. According to the press service of the capital’s police department, measures are being taken to detain other accomplices of the criminal.
On this fact, a criminal case has been initiated under article 169 (theft) of the Criminal Code.
